Comprehending Interstitial Lung Disease
Interstitial lung illness is a group of lung conditions that impact the interstitium, the tissue and area around the air sacs (alveoli) in the lungs. The interstitium is accountable for supporting the alveoli and helping with the exchange of oxygen and co2. When this tissue becomes inflamed or scarred, it can cause a variety of signs and complications.
Kinds of ILD:
- Idiopathic Pulmonary Fibrosis (IPF): A progressive and typically deadly form of ILD without any recognized cause.
- Hypersensitivity Pneumonitis: An allergy to inhaled organic dusts or chemicals.
- Sarcoidosis: An inflammatory illness that can affect multiple organs, but primarily the lungs.
- Occupational ILD: Caused by prolonged exposure to specific occupational dangers, such as silica, asbestos, and coal dust.
The Railroad Industry and ILD
Railroad workers are at a greater danger of developing ILD due to their extended direct exposure to various environmental and occupational risks. Some of the crucial aspects consist of:
Dust and Particulate Matter:
- Coal Dust: Workers in coal-fired engines are exposed to coal dust, which can trigger chronic lung irritation and inflammation.
- Diesel Exhaust: Diesel engines emit fine particulate matter and hazardous gases, including nitrogen dioxide and sulfur dioxide, which can damage the lungs gradually.
- Asbestos: Older railroad cars and structures might include asbestos, a known carcinogen that can trigger lung cancer and asbestosis.
Chemical Exposures:
- Solvents and Cleaners: Railroad employees often utilize solvents and cleaning up agents that can release unpredictable organic compounds (VOCs) and other damaging chemicals.
- Lubricants and Greases: These can include dangerous compounds that, when breathed in, can cause respiratory problems.

Symptoms and Diagnosis
The symptoms of ILD can vary depending on the type and intensity of the illness. Typical signs consist of:
- Shortness of Breath: Especially during physical activity.
- Dry Cough: Persistent and frequently ineffective.
- Fatigue: Generalized tiredness and absence of energy.
- Chest Pain: Often referred to as a dull pains or sharp discomfort.
- Weight reduction: Unintentional and frequently rapid.
Diagnosis:
- Physical Examination: A doctor will listen to the lungs and examine for signs of breathing distress.
- Imaging Tests: Chest X-rays and CT scans can assist envision lung damage and inflammation.
- Pulmonary Function Tests: These tests procedure lung capability and the capability to exchange oxygen and carbon dioxide.
- Biopsy: In some cases, a lung biopsy might be necessary to validate the medical diagnosis.
Treatment and Management
While there is no treatment for ILD, a number of treatment options can help handle symptoms and slow the development of the illness:
Medications:
- Anti-inflammatory Drugs: Corticosteroids can reduce inflammation in the lungs.
- Antifibrotic Drugs: Medications like pirfenidone and nintedanib can slow the scarring procedure.
- Oxygen Therapy: Supplemental oxygen can enhance breathing and decrease shortness of breath.
Way of life Changes:
- Smoking Cessation: Quitting smoking is essential for avoiding more lung damage.
- Exercise: Regular, low-impact exercise can improve lung function and overall health.
- Diet plan: A balanced diet plan abundant in anti-oxidants and anti-inflammatory foods can support lung health.
Supportive Care:
- Pulmonary Rehabilitation: Programs that combine workout, education, and support to enhance lifestyle.
- Assistance Groups: Connecting with others who have ILD can provide psychological support and practical suggestions.
Preventive Measures
Avoiding ILD in railroad workers involves a multi-faceted approach that includes both specific and organizational efforts:
Personal Protective Equipment (PPE):
- Respirators: Wearing N95 respirators can reduce exposure to dust and particulate matter.
- Gloves and Goggles: Protecting the skin and eyes from chemical exposures.
Office Safety:
- Ventilation: Ensuring correct ventilation in workspace to reduce the concentration of harmful compounds.
- Routine Maintenance: Keeping equipment and equipment in good working order to minimize emissions.
- Training: Providing workers with training on the proper use of PPE and safe work practices.
Health Monitoring:
- Regular Check-ups: Scheduling routine medical check-ups to keep an eye on lung health.
- Screening Programs: Implementing screening programs to identify early indications of ILD.
Often Asked Questions (FAQs)
Q: What are the early indications of interstitial lung illness?A: Early signs of ILD consist of shortness of breath, especially throughout exercise, a dry cough, and fatigue. These symptoms may be subtle at very first however can intensify gradually.
Q: Can ILD be reversed?A: While some kinds of ILD can improve with treatment, numerous cases are progressive and irreversible. The objective of treatment is to handle symptoms and slow the progression of the disease.
Q: How can railroad employees lower their risk of developing ILD?A: Railroad workers can lower their danger by using appropriate PPE, guaranteeing excellent ventilation in workspace, and following safe work practices. Regular health check-ups and screenings are also essential.
Q: What should I do if I presume I have ILD?A: If you believe you have ILD, it is necessary to seek medical attention promptly. A health care company can carry out a physical exam, order imaging tests, and carry out lung function tests to identify the condition.
Q: Are there any support system for individuals with ILD?A: Yes, there are several support system and organizations that provide resources and support for individuals with ILD. These groups can provide psychological support, practical suggestions, and information about treatment options.
